#include <fstream>
#include <miopen/tmp_dir.hpp>
#include <gtest/gtest.h>
TEST(CPU_kernel_inliner_NONE, InlinerTest)
{
const miopen::TmpDir test_srcs{"test_include_inliner"};
const auto bin_path = miopen::fs::path(::testing::internal::GetArgvs().front()).parent_path();
const auto addkernels = miopen::make_executable_name(bin_path / "addkernels").string();
auto Child = [&](const miopen::fs::path& source) {
return test_srcs.Execute(addkernels, "-source " + source);
};
const auto header_filename = "header.h";
const auto asm_src = test_srcs / "valid.s";
const auto valid_src = test_srcs / "valid.cl";
const auto invalid_src = test_srcs / "invalid.cl";
const auto header_src = test_srcs / header_filename;
std::ofstream(valid_src.c_str()) << "#include <" << header_filename << ">\n" //
<< "#include \"" << header_filename << "\"\n" //
<< "//inliner-include-optional\n" //
<< "#include <missing_header.h>" << std::endl; //
std::ofstream(asm_src.c_str()) << ".include \"" << header_filename << "\"" << std::endl;
std::ofstream(invalid_src.c_str()) << "#include <missing_header.h>" << std::endl;
std::ofstream(header_src.c_str()) << std::endl;
EXPECT_EQ(0, Child(valid_src));
EXPECT_EQ(0, Child(asm_src));
EXPECT_EQ(1, Child(invalid_src));
}
